我用Linux编写了我的代码,它是在Linux平台上编译的,最近,我在跨平台项目下导入了visual studio 2017企业的代码。我的远程构建器是在其上编译代码的机器。但是,当试图通过VS构建项目时,它无法找到一些头文件,如或或等,并且生成将失败。我发现用于包含文件(VC\Linux\include\usr\include\c++\5等)的VS路径不包含丢失的头文件。
我刚刚从Linux Mint 9升级到Linux Mint 14,现在Netbeans找不到构建我的项目所需的许多标准头文件。在Linux升级之前,一切都运行得很好。我尝试查看了Netbeans用于搜索两个版本的Netbeans的标准头文件的路径,它们是相同的。这些头文件的位置是否可能在不同的发行版中有所不同,或者它们的位置是GNU标准(或Linux标准)的一部分吗?我想,如果找不到其他解决方案,我可以简单地恢复到较旧的操作系统,但我